#0e4a85 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0e4a85 is composed of 5.5% red, 29%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 209.7 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 28.8%. #0e4a85 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c94ff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#0e4a85

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010509 is the darkest color, while #f6f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0e4a85

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474a4c is the less saturated color, while #034a90 is the most saturated one.
